Data: Early ETH whale sold 11,200 tokens in the past two weeks, realizing over $31 million in profit
According to ChainCatcher, on-chain analyst AiYi (@ai_9684xtpa) has monitored that "smart money" accounts that began accumulating ETH in September 2020 have reportedly sold 11,185 ETH in the past two weeks. Their cost basis was as low as $906.5, and if sold, this would yield a profit of $31.35 million.
Address 0x306...6Ab84 deposited 5,000 ETH, worth $19.21 million, to an exchange six hours ago, and simultaneously submitted a redemption request for 6,383.53 ETH on Lido. This is the address's second large deposit to a trading platform this month; the previous deposit was two weeks ago, with 6,185 ETH worth approximately $22.28 million. Between September 2020 and February 2025, this address and its funding sources accumulated 39,546.52 ETH at an average price of $906.5. It currently still holds 10,513.14 ETH.
